What to Consider Before Buying a Convertible Stroller System
A convertible stroller system, often categorized as a standard stroller, is more than just an item; it’s a key solution for navigating daily life with a baby. It’s your vehicle for neighborhood walks, grocery runs, and park adventures. The main benefit of a 2-in-1 system like the INFANS 2-in-1 Reversible Baby Stroller Bassinet is its incredible value and versatility. It eliminates the need for a separate bassinet purchase by integrating it directly into the stroller’s seat structure, saving both money and precious storage space. It’s designed to grow with your child, from their very first outing until they’re ready to walk full-time.
The ideal customer for this type of product is a first-time parent, or any parent looking for a single, cost-effective solution for one child from birth to age three. It’s perfect for families living in urban or suburban environments who need a reliable workhorse for paved sidewalks, parks, and shopping centers. However, it might not be suitable for those who are serious joggers needing a specialized running stroller with advanced suspension, or for families who travel by air frequently and require an ultra-compact, gate-check-friendly model. For parents of twins or two children close in age, a double stroller would be a more practical alternative.
Before investing, consider these crucial points in detail:
- Dimensions & Space: Pay close attention to the stroller’s folded dimensions to ensure it will fit comfortably in your vehicle’s trunk. The unfolded “high landscape” design is a significant feature, as it raises your baby higher off the ground, away from car exhaust and closer to you for better interaction. Also, consider its width for navigating tight store aisles.
- Capacity/Performance: The stroller should clearly state its age and weight capacity, typically from 0 to 3 years. We evaluate performance by testing the wheel suspension on various common terrains like cracked pavement and grassy parks. The ability of the front wheels to swivel 360 degrees for maneuverability or lock for stability is a key performance metric.
- Materials & Durability: A frame made from aluminum alloy, like the one on the INFANS stroller, offers a great balance of strength and manageable weight. The fabric, usually Oxford cloth, should be durable, easy to clean, and non-toxic for your child’s safety. Check the quality of the wheels—solid, puncture-proof wheels are a must for long-term, hassle-free use.
- Ease of Use & Maintenance: How intuitive is the folding mechanism? Can it be done quickly when you have your hands full? We look for a simple conversion process between bassinet and seat modes. For maintenance, removable and washable fabrics, particularly for the storage basket, are a huge plus for dealing with inevitable spills and messes.

The Magic Trick: Seamless Conversion from Bassinet to Toddler Seat
The standout feature of this stroller is undoubtedly its 2-in-1 convertible seat. For the first few months, we used it exclusively in the lie-flat bassinet mode. This provides a safe, cozy, and ergonomically correct environment for a newborn, eliminating the need for a separate pram. The included foot cover is a fantastic touch, creating a snug cocoon that protected our little one from chilly winds during autumn walks. We found it provided the kind of warmth and security that lets a baby sleep soundly on the go.
Converting it from bassinet to toddler seat is a clever process involving a few clips and straps underneath the unit. It’s not an instant, one-handed switch, but it’s a simple, one-time adjustment that takes less than a minute once you know how. The result is a secure, structured toddler seat with three distinct recline positions. We could have our child sitting upright and observing the world, in a relaxed recline for a bottle, or nearly flat for a nap. One critical aspect we confirmed from a user review: to get the seat to sit up properly, you must locate and connect the clips hidden at the bottom, underneath the seat. It’s a slightly non-intuitive step, but once done, the seat is perfectly supportive. The ability to reverse the seat—facing us for bonding and reassurance, then facing the world as curiosity grew—is a premium feature that we used constantly. This adaptability is truly a feature that sets it apart in its price category.
On the Move: Maneuverability, Suspension, and the “High Landscape” Advantage
Pushing the INFANS stroller is a generally smooth experience. On sidewalks, in stores, and across smooth park paths, it glides effortlessly. The 360-degree rotating front wheels make tight turns a breeze, allowing us to navigate crowded cafes and narrow store aisles without any trouble. When facing a longer, straight path, the wheels can be locked forward for added stability. The foot-activated rear brake is large and easy to engage with a single tap, holding the stroller firmly in place even on a slight incline.
The “high landscape” design is more than just a marketing term. We genuinely appreciated having our baby positioned higher up. It made it easier to interact with them without constantly bending over, and it provided peace of mind knowing they were further away from the dust and exhaust fumes of city streets. While the stroller is equipped with a shock-absorbing wheel system, it’s important to set realistic expectations. It handles bumps on the sidewalk and short grass admirably, but as one user accurately pointed out, the suspension could be better. On more rugged terrain like gravel paths or uneven parkland, the ride can get a bit jittery. It’s a city and suburb stroller through and through, not an all-terrain trailblazer.
Parent-Friendly by Design: Folding, Storage, and Daily Conveniences
INFANS clearly considered the parent’s experience when designing this stroller. The folding mechanism is intuitive and can be accomplished relatively easily. A huge plus we confirmed from user feedback is the ability to fold the stroller with the seat still attached, which is a massive time-saver. Once folded, it’s reasonably compact and includes a shoulder strap for carrying, though it still has some heft. We found it fit well in the trunk of our sedan with room to spare.
The storage basket underneath is a showstopper. One parent noted, “I loved most when I saw it was how big the storage looked underneath and it holds so much honestly,” and we couldn’t agree more. It easily accommodated a loaded diaper bag, a few bags of groceries, and a loose jacket with room to spare. This isn’t just a basket; it’s a mobile storage unit. Another thoughtful detail is a zipper on the basket lining, which a user pointed out makes it easy to remove for cleaning—brilliant. The adjustable canopy provides excellent coverage, and the extra sun visor and peek-a-boo window are features we used on every single outing. The one significant letdown, as mentioned in our cons and confirmed by a user whose bottle warmer kept falling, is the cup holder. It’s a flimsy plastic attachment that rotates far too easily to be trusted with a hot coffee. It’s a minor flaw in an otherwise stellar design, but one to be aware of.

The Baby Trend Snap-N-Go is not a direct competitor but a solution for a different problem: transporting two infants. This is a lightweight frame stroller designed to carry two infant car seats simultaneously. It’s an excellent choice for parents of twins or two children very close in age during their first year. Its primary advantage is convenience; you can move sleeping babies from the car to the stroller without unbuckling them. However, its lifespan is limited. Once your children outgrow their infant car seats, this stroller frame becomes obsolete. The INFANS stroller, by contrast, is a complete single-child solution that lasts from birth up to three years.

The EVER ADVANCED Foldable Wagon occupies a different niche entirely. This is less of a stroller and more of a kid-and-cargo hauler. It’s perfect for families with two older toddlers who have outgrown a traditional stroller but still need a ride for long outings like trips to the zoo, beach, or farmer’s market. Its massive storage capacity and rugged wheels make it incredibly practical for these scenarios. While it features a 5-point harness, it doesn’t offer the recline positions or bassinet functionality necessary for an infant. Choose the wagon for hauling toddlers and gear; choose the INFANS stroller for the infant-to-toddler years.
